Rangers eye Turkey and Besiktas starlet Ridvan Yilmaz

Rangers are exploring a potential move for highly-rated Besiktas left-back Ridvan Yilmaz after completing the £4million signing of central defender Ben Davies.

Yilmaz, 21, already has six senior caps for Turkey. He came through Besiktas’ youth system, progressing to a first-team debut in April 2019 and helping them win the 2020-21 league title. 

Now entering the final year of his contract with the Istanbul club, he would likely cost in excess of £4m if Rangers pursue a permanent deal.

With Calvin Bassey poised to complete his £20m switch to Ajax, the Ibrox club have already secured Davies from Liverpool in a switch worth an initial £3m plus a further £1m in add-ons.

That transfer has been given a firm seal of approval by Jurgen Klopp, who believes it’s the ‘perfect’ move for a defender approaching his prime.

Davies was confirmed as Giovanni van Bronckhorst’s sixth summer addition shortly before kick-off in last night’s 3-1 friendly win against West Ham.

Davies, who has signed a four-year contract at Ibrox, didn’t make a senior appearance at Anfield after being signed in a £500,000 switch from Preston and spent last season at Sheffield United.

However, Liverpool boss Klopp delivered a glowing appraisal of his character and backed him to be a major success in Scotland. ‘It’s a smart piece of recruitment from Giovanni van Bronckhorst,’ said Klopp. 

‘Perfect for all parties. He has himself an accomplished defender, who is entering his peak years and whose character is top drawer.’

Davies, who previously attracted interest from Celtic before joining Liverpool in February 2021, was delighted to join last season’s Europa League finalists.
